The most "plausible" Lewis structure is the one that has the formal charge closest to zero, we want atoms to have formal charges of zero or get as close to zero as possible. For example, if there is a lewis structure where N has a +1 FC and another in which N has a FC of zero, the second structure would be preferable. Re: HClO3 Bond Angles. Let's take a look at the oxygen that is bonded to hydrogen. That specific oxygen atom is bonded to two atoms, Cl and H, and has 2 lone pairs. This makes 4 e- densities. Its e- geometry is thus tetrahedral, and its molecular geometry is bent. Be sure to minimize formal charges.The Lewis structure of a nitrate [NO 3] - ion displays a total of 24 valence electrons, i.e., 24/2 = 12 electron pairs. A nitrogen (N) atom is present at the center. It is bonded to 2 O-atoms via single covalent bonds and to 1 O-atom via a double covalent bond.
